    God, not this again...

    This has been clarified many times. Microsoft is not keylogging. There is no "utility to capture keystrokes". What there is, is the *EXACT SAME THING* that has been in windows since, I think IE8, and Microsoft has just clarified this in their EULA.

    What they are referring to is the "feature" of Internet explorer to correct spelling. As you type, the words get sent to Microsoft to verify spelling, and little red squigglies show up under them when they are not real words... like "squigglies". Microsoft does not capture or retain this information in non-beta versions, but the fact that it's sent to them means it does pass through routers and can possibly end up in log files.... even in production versions. This is MS "Covering their rears". And it's a feature that is in Windows 8.1, Windows 8, and Windows 7. You can disable it by turning off spell-checking, just like you can disable smart-screen to prevent Microsoft from seeing the websites you visit. Microsoft also collects "keystrokes" when you type in the address bar for autocomplete purposes, since those get sent to Microsoft as well so that they can return autocomplete results to you.

    That is *ALL* this hubbub is. So please stop willfully repeating this nonsense about keyloggers in Windows 10. It's nothing that's not in every version of Windows since at least Windows 7.

    The only difference here is that it's in the EULA. Certainly Windows 10 collects all kinds of other data as well, much of that data is actually newly collected. This particular feature is not new. And Microsoft has said they are analyzing the spelling and autocomplete data to improve the feature in Windows 10. But the same risk is there regardless.

    Either you trust MS with that data or you don't. If you don't, then you shouldn't be trusting that they aren't recording and saving that data in Windows 7, 8, and 8.1 either.
